Ejemplo n.º 1
0
        public static Task <decimal?> ObtenerMontoTotalSinIva(int idSucursal, int?numero, NotaPedidoEstado?estado, TipoCliente?tipoCliente, DateTime?fechaDesde, DateTime?fechaHasta, int?idVendedor, string nombreCliente)
        {
            INotaPedidoRepository NotaPedidoRepository = new NotaPedidoRepository(new VentaContext());

            return(NotaPedidoRepository.ObtenerMontoTotalSinIva(idSucursal, numero, estado, tipoCliente, fechaDesde, fechaHasta, idVendedor, nombreCliente));
        }
Ejemplo n.º 2
0
        public static Task <List <NotaPedido> > BuscarAsync(TipoBase tipoBase, int idClienteMayorista, NotaPedidoEstado?estado, string ordenadoPor, OrdenadoDireccion ordenarDireccion, int pagina, int itemsPorPagina, out int totalElementos)
        {
            INotaPedidoRepository NotaPedidoRepository = new NotaPedidoRepository(new VentaContext(tipoBase));

            return(NotaPedidoRepository.BuscarAsync(idClienteMayorista, estado, ordenadoPor, ordenarDireccion, pagina, itemsPorPagina, out totalElementos));
        }
Ejemplo n.º 3
0
        public static Task <List <NotaPedido> > BuscarAsync(int idSucursal, int?idProducto, List <NotaPedidoEstado> estados, string ordenadoPor, OrdenadoDireccion ordenarDireccion, int pagina, int itemsPorPagina, out int totalElementos)
        {
            INotaPedidoRepository NotaPedidoRepository = new NotaPedidoRepository(new VentaContext());

            return(NotaPedidoRepository.BuscarAsync(idSucursal, idProducto, estados, ordenadoPor, ordenarDireccion, pagina, itemsPorPagina, out totalElementos));
        }
Ejemplo n.º 4
0
        public static Task <List <NotaPedido> > BuscarAsync(int idSucursal, int?numero, NotaPedidoEstado?estado, TipoCliente?tipoCliente, DateTime?fechaDesde, DateTime?fechaHasta, int?idVendedor, string nombreCliente, string ordenadoPor, OrdenadoDireccion ordenarDireccion, int pagina, int itemsPorPagina, out int totalElementos)
        {
            INotaPedidoRepository NotaPedidoRepository = new NotaPedidoRepository(new VentaContext());

            return(NotaPedidoRepository.BuscarAsync(idSucursal, numero, estado, tipoCliente, fechaDesde, fechaHasta, idVendedor, nombreCliente, ordenadoPor, ordenarDireccion, pagina, itemsPorPagina, out totalElementos));
        }
Ejemplo n.º 5
0
        public static Task <NotaPedido> ObtenerAsync(long idNotaPedido)
        {
            INotaPedidoRepository NotaPedidoRepository = new NotaPedidoRepository(new VentaContext());

            return(NotaPedidoRepository.ObtenerAsync(idNotaPedido));
        }
Ejemplo n.º 6
0
        public static Task GuardarAsync(NotaPedido notaPedidoModel)
        {
            INotaPedidoRepository NotaPedidoRepository = new NotaPedidoRepository(new VentaContext());

            return(NotaPedidoRepository.GuardarAsync(notaPedidoModel));
        }